Odor Removal After Water Damage Cost In Johnsonville, NC

The cost of odor removal after water damage can vary depending on the severity, size of affected area, and local conditions in Johnsonville, NC. On average, the cost can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age and the level of restoration required.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Dehumidification and Odor Removal $500 - $1,500 Severity of odor, size of affected area, and local conditions
Content Restoration and Cleaning $200 - $1,000 Type of content, extent of damage, and level of cleaning required
Drying and Water Extraction $200 - $1,000 Severity of water damage, size of affected area, and level of equipment required
Structural Drying and Repair $1,000 - $5,000 Severity of structural damage, size of affected area, and level of repair required
Inspection and Assessment $100 - $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and level of detail required
Free Estimate and Consultation $0 - $200 Cost varies depending on the level of consultation and estimate required

The cost of odor removal after water damage can vary depending on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a free estimate and consultation to help you understand the costs and scope of the work involved.

Q: Can I use bleach to remove odors after water damage?

A: No, it's not recommended to use bleach to remove odors after water damage. Bleach can damage surfaces and fabrics, and it may not effectively remove the odor. Our team uses specialized equipment and techniques to ensure that the odor is removed safely and effectively.

Q: How do I prevent water damage and odors in my home?

A: To prevent water damage and odors in your home, it's essential to address any issues quickly and take preventive measures. Regularly inspect your home for signs of water damage, and address any issues with your plumbing, appliances, and roof. Consider investing in a sump pump, water sensor, or other safety devices to help detect and prevent water damage.
